I've had one of these since the end of March 2011; it's extremely good for what it is.
It is NOT an iPad, but...
I watch BBC iPlayer and YouTube on it. I've transferred all my books from my Kindle onto it. I play Angry Birds and Stupid Zombies almost every day, then I play poker against the rest of the world at night!
There is only one seller on Amazon, Wendy-Lou, but what a seller; read the praise on the feedback pages; the customer service is almost incredible; if I hadn't had a minor problem that was resolved with such courtesy, promptness and helpfulness, I wouldn't be singing Wendy's praises.
What it lacks: GPS, phone capability.
What it's got: Everything else!!

Just got one yesterday. I have not owned a tablet before, so have nothing to compare it with so please keep that in mind.

The first thing that struck me was that it was slightly thicker and heavier than I expected - so check the specs and make sure you're happy with them. The next thing I found was that there appears to be no driver for it for my windows XP machine. I am starting out as an app developer and it is essential that I be able to communicate with the tablet. Does anyone know where I can get a driver?

Another thing I have discovered is that tabtach and natpc appear to be one and the same thing - so if you are searching the web for info about this tablet, you need to look up both variations.

When the power cable is plugged in, the power-on indicator is so bright that I've had to put a bit of tape over it to stop it dazzling me!

Apart from that, it all seems to be working fine so far. I'll post more if I find anything interesting.
